What Are Door Bottom Seals?
Door bottom seals are strips of material installed at the bottom edge of doors. Their primary function is to fill the space in between the door and the floor, avoiding drafts, moisture, and unwanted bugs from going into an area. They are available in different products, sizes, and styles, making it simple to discover a suitable choice for any door.

Advantages of Door Bottom Seals
Setting up door bottom seals can cause a variety of benefits that enhance both the living and working environment. Here are some considerable benefits:
1. Energy Efficiency
One of the main benefits of door bottom seals is their ability to enhance energy performance. By sealing spaces at the bottom of doors, they lessen drafts and heat loss, which can result in lower heating and cooling costs. This not just conserves cash however also contributes to environmental sustainability.
2. Sound Reduction

3. Bug Control
Unwanted bugs like rodents and pests frequently penetrate spaces through tiny gaps in doors. By successfully sealing these gaps, door bottom seals can assist keep bugs at bay, minimizing the need for chemical bug control approaches.
4. Moisture Protection
In areas with high humidity or heavy rainfall, wetness can permeate through the fractures at the bottom of doors, resulting in mold development and damage. Door bottom seals act as a barrier versus moisture, safeguarding floorings and interiors from water damage.
5. Aesthetic Appeal
Modern door bottom seals can be found in different designs that can match the decoration of any space. Picking an appealing seal can enhance the overall look of a door, making it look more refined and completed.
Installation Guide
Setting up door bottom seals is a straightforward process that lots of property owners can undertake themselves. Here’s a detailed guide to assist you through the setup:
Tools and Materials Needed
- Door bottom seal
- Determining tape
- Utility knife or scissors
- Screwdriver (if needed)
- Adhesive (if relevant)
Steps to Install
- Procedure the Door Width: Use a measuring tape to identify the width of your door. This measurement will help you pick the best length of seal.
- Select the Seal: Choose a door bottom seal that matches your needs. Ensure to represent the kind of door and any particular requirements like soundproofing or moisture resistance.
- Cut the Seal: Using an energy knife or scissors, cut the seal to the suitable length based on your measurements.
- Tidy the Door Bottom: Ensure the area where you’ll be installing the seal is tidy and free from particles. This will ensure better adhesion if your seal uses adhesive.
- Attach the Seal: If the seal has adhesive backing, just peel off the protective layer and press it securely onto the door bottom. If it requires screws, position the seal and secure it securely using a screwdriver.
- Test the Seal: Close the door and visually examine the fit of the seal. Make adjustments if required to ensure a tight seal.
Upkeep of Door Bottom Seals
To optimize the life expectancy and efficiency of door bottom seals, routine upkeep is necessary. Here are some pointers for correct care:
- Inspect Regularly: Periodically examine the seals for wear and tear. Search for cracks, spaces, or loose areas that might require attention.
- Tidy the Seals: Use a moist fabric to clean down seals and eliminate dust, dirt, or particles that can affect their efficiency.
- Replace When Necessary: If a seal is harmed or worn, consider replacing it quickly to preserve energy performance and comfort.
